4 Key Components of Headless Commerce Development

A successful headless commerce implementation relies on several interconnected components working together seamlessly.

Each component plays a distinct role in delivering fast, flexible, and engaging shopping experiences. Understanding these building blocks can help you design an architecture that supports both your current business needs and future growth.

1. Backend Commerce Platform

The backend commerce platform serves as the foundation of your headless commerce ecosystem. It manages core commerce functions such as product catalogs, inventory, pricing, promotions, customer accounts, carts, checkout, and order management.

Since the backend operates independently from the frontend, you can continue running essential business operations while giving your development teams the freedom to create custom customer experiences.

This separation also makes it easier to scale operations, integrate third-party services, and introduce new capabilities without disrupting existing storefronts.

2. Frontend Presentation Layer(s)

The frontend is the customer-facing layer where shoppers browse products, search for items, add products to their carts, and complete purchases. In a headless architecture, you are not restricted to a single storefront.

You can build multiple presentation layers for websites, mobile applications, smart devices, kiosks, and other digital touchpoints while using the same backend commerce engine. 

This flexibility allows you to create channel-specific experiences that align with customer expectations and brand requirements. You can also leverage modern frontend frameworks such as React, Vue, or Angular to build highly interactive, fast, and responsive user experiences.

3. Headless CMS (Content Management System)

Content plays a critical role in influencing purchase decisions. Product descriptions, landing pages, blogs, banners, and promotional campaigns all contribute to the customer experience.

A headless CMS integration allows your content and marketing teams to create, manage, and publish content independently of the ecommerce platform. Because content is delivered through APIs, you can reuse and distribute it across multiple channels from a single source. 

This approach enables your teams to launch campaigns faster, maintain content consistency, and deliver personalized experiences across every customer touchpoint.

4. APIs

Headless commerce api development is the backbone of any ecommerce business. They enable communication among the frontend, the backend commerce platform, the CMS, payment gateways, ecommerce CRM systems, ERP solutions, and other third-party services. Whenever a customer views a product, updates a cart, or completes a purchase, APIs facilitate real-time information exchange between systems.

Well-designed APIs allow you to integrate new services quickly, support omnichannel experiences, and scale your commerce ecosystem as business requirements evolve. Without APIs, the flexibility and agility that define headless commerce would not be possible.

How to implement a headless commerce solution

Building a headless commerce solution requires careful planning and execution. A structured approach can help you reduce implementation risks and ensure a smooth transition to a headless architecture.

1. Evaluate Your Business Needs

Before touching any technology, audit where your current stack is falling short. Look at your existing tech stack, digital footprint, integration needs, and your team’s technical maturity to define a clear vision for headless commerce that aligns with your business objectives.

This is also the stage to get stakeholder buy-in: headless is a significant shift, and it’s a major business decision requiring the right resources and stringent planning, so alignment across marketing, IT, and leadership matters early. Consider whether a phased rollout makes sense rather than an all-at-once cutover.

2. Choose the Right Headless Commerce Platform

Compare platforms on scalability, API completeness (REST vs GraphQL), flexibility, and how well they fit your existing architecture. It also helps to know that headless isn’t one single architecture but a spectrum:

  • Pure Headless: front-end and back-end are decoupled and communicate via APIs. This is the simplest starting point, often a good fit for smaller teams or early-stage D2C brands.
  • Composable Commerce goes a step further by combining best-of-breed services (search, payments, CMS, inventory) rather than relying on one all-in-one platform. Suits businesses with complex catalogs or workflows, like B2B.
  • MACH Architecture (Microservices, API-first, Cloud-native, Headless): the engineering foundation most composable stacks are built on, favored by larger B2C operations scaling across regions and channels.

You’ll also need to select a back-end commerce platform that supports headless architecture (Shopify, BigCommerce, or Magento are common choices) and a separate and most popular headless CMS to manage content in a decoupled environment.

3. Develop a Migration Plan

With a platform chosen, map out how you’ll move without disrupting the live business. A well-laid migration plan should cover transferring all data, confirming the new system functions as expected, and making sure existing workflows aren’t harmed in the transition.

This is also where you assign ownership: we recommend naming a “captain” from each affected department to oversee their piece of the implementation and its impact on their team.

4. Ecommerce Infrastructure Setup

Set up the underlying environment: hosting, cloud resources, dev/staging/production environments, and a security baseline.

This means setting up the environment, configuring the platform, and developing the necessary integrations your business will rely on going forward. This is also the natural point to budget for ongoing infrastructure costs, not just the initial build.

5. Back-End Development (Platform-Based or Microservices-Based)

Build out the commerce engine itself: catalog, cart, checkout, pricing, promotions, inventory, and order management. You’ll decide here whether to build on a single platform-based backend or a fully composable, microservices-based architecture, where every part of the tech stack functions independently and is combined into a tailored solution.

6. Front-End Development for Different Customer Touchpoints

Build the experience layer: web, mobile app, kiosk, voice assistant, and so on, using a modern framework. Headless lets you build a React Native app, drop in a Next.js kiosk, or run an Alexa skill while proven commerce APIs handle carts, payments, and inventory.

Pay attention to rendering strategy here: fast first paint and crawlable HTML matter, since a headless single-page app that ships a blank shell to search crawlers will quietly hurt organic traffic.

7. Set Up API Connections Between Front-End and Back-End Layers

This is the connective tissue of the whole architecture. Synchronous API calls handle anything the shopper waits on (price, availability, applying a coupon, placing an order), while asynchronous webhooks handle state changes you react to, like an order being created or stock being decremented.

Some guides recommend using semantic versioning to signal risk, enforcing deprecation windows, and toggling new functionality with feature flags instead of hard cuts, so front-end and back-end teams can move independently without breaking each other.

8. Integration with Third-Party Business Systems

Connect the supporting systems that make the storefront fully functional: payment gateways, search providers, ERP, reviews, and analytics. A common composable example pairs a commerce backend with a separate ecommerce CMS for content, a dedicated search provider, and a payments processor, all connected via APIs.

9. Implementing and Testing

Once everything is built and wired together, move into structured QA. This includes functional testing to confirm all commerce features work as expected, performance testing to ensure the site loads quickly and can handle traffic spikes, and security testing to verify protection of customer data and transactions.

10. Going Live and Performance Monitoring

After cutover, the work shifts to observation and iteration. Once the store is live, the focus turns to monitoring performance, confirming everything is functioning correctly, and gathering analytics to guide continuous improvement.

Define your success metrics (adoption, productivity, ROI) and revisit them regularly, since that’s how you demonstrate the migration actually paid off, as Contentstack’s roadmap also emphasizes for the post-launch phase..

Headless eCommerce Best Practices to Boost Security

Headless commerce gives you the flexibility to build exceptional digital experiences, but it also introduces multiple integration points that need to be secured. Following these best practices can help you protect customer data, reduce vulnerabilities, and maintain a resilient commerce ecosystem.

1. Implement Robust API Security

APIs are the backbone of headless commerce, making them a prime target for cyberattacks. Protect your APIs by implementing strong authentication methods, encryption, rate limiting, and continuous monitoring. Regular API audits can also help you identify and address potential vulnerabilities before they become serious threats.

2. Secure CI/CD Pipelines

Your development and deployment pipelines play a critical role in application security. Secure your CI/CD workflows by restricting access, scanning code for vulnerabilities, and securely managing credentials and secrets. This helps prevent security issues from entering your production environment.

3. Enforce Strong Authentication and Access Controls

Not every user needs access to every system or resource. Implement role-based access controls, enforce strong password policies, and enable multi-factor authentication to ensure that only authorized users can access sensitive systems and data.

4. Deploy Web Application Firewalls (WAF) and DDoS Protection

A Web Application Firewall helps protect your storefront from common threats such as SQL injection, cross-site scripting, and malicious bot traffic. Combining WAF with DDoS protection can further safeguard your commerce platform against traffic spikes and large-scale cyberattacks.

5. Maintain Regular Security Updates and Content Security Policies

Outdated software and integrations can expose your business to security risks. Regularly update your commerce platform, third-party services, and dependencies to patch known vulnerabilities. You should also implement Content Security Policies to control how resources are loaded and reduce the risk of client-side attacks.

Common Development Challenges and Solutions

While headless commerce offers significant flexibility and scalability, implementing it is not without challenges. Understanding these obstacles early can help you plan effectively and ensure a smoother implementation journey.

Headless commerce challenges

1. Higher Upfront Development Costs and Complexity

Building a headless commerce solution often requires a larger initial investment than traditional ecommerce platforms. Since the frontend, backend, APIs, and integrations need to be developed and managed separately, implementation can become complex.

Solution: Start with a clear roadmap and prioritize business-critical features for your initial launch. Adopting an MVP approach can help you control costs while delivering value faster.

2. Need for Skilled Developers and Ongoing Maintenance

Headless commerce for B2B requires expertise in modern frontend frameworks, APIs, cloud infrastructure, and integrations. In addition, multiple services and applications need ongoing monitoring, updates, and optimization.

Solution: Build a team with the right technical expertise or partner with an experienced headless commerce development company. Establishing ongoing maintenance and support processes will also help ensure long-term stability.

3. Managing Multiple Vendor Relationships

A headless architecture often involves several technology providers, including commerce platforms, CMS vendors, payment gateways, search solutions, and analytics tools. Coordinating multiple vendors can increase operational complexity.

Solution: Choose technologies that integrate well with each other and define clear ownership and communication processes. Using API management and orchestration tools can also simplify integration management.

4. Longer Initial Time-to-Market

Development and integration efforts can take longer compared to deploying a traditional out-of-the-box platform, because headless commerce solutions are highly customizable, 

Solution: Break the implementation into phases and launch a minimum viable product first. An agile development approach allows you to release core functionality quickly while continuously adding new features and improvements.

Enterprise Headless Commerce Implementation Cost

The cost of headless commerce development can vary significantly based on your business requirements and the complexity of the solution.

Factors such as the scope of frontend customization, the number of backend integrations, the technologies selected, and whether you are migrating from an existing platform or building a new composable ecosystem all influence the overall investment.

If you are looking to build a focused headless storefront with essential commerce capabilities, development costs typically start at around $75,000.

However, if your business requires a fully composable architecture with multi-region storefronts, AI-driven ecommerce personalization, ERP integration, and advanced omnichannel order management system capabilities, costs can range from $200,000 to over $1 million.

To avoid unexpected expenses, it is important to begin with detailed architecture planning and clear project scoping. Defining requirements early gives you better visibility into timelines, milestones, and the total investment needed to successfully deliver your headless commerce solution.

FAQ’s

1. What is headless ecommerce?

Headless ecommerce is an architecture where the frontend is separated from the backend. This allows businesses to build custom customer experiences while managing products, orders, and other commerce functions from a centralized backend.

2. What is headless commerce architecture?

Headless commerce architecture decouples the presentation layer from the commerce engine. APIs connect these independent systems, making it easier to customize storefronts, integrate third-party tools, and scale across multiple digital channels.

3. How does headless commerce work?

Headless commerce uses APIs to exchange data between the frontend and backend. This enables websites, mobile apps, marketplaces, and other touchpoints to access the same commerce services without being tightly connected to the backend.

4. What is the top-rated headless CMS for commerce?

The right headless CMS depends on your business needs. Popular options include Contentful, Strapi, Sanity, and Storyblok. When evaluating solutions for enterprise headless commerce, consider scalability, API capabilities, integration support, and content management requirements.

5. How does headless commerce reduce time to market?

Since the frontend and backend operate independently, development teams can work on different components simultaneously. This allows businesses to launch new features, campaigns, and digital channels much faster than traditional commerce platforms.

6. How do you build a headless commerce storefront?

Building a headless storefront typically involves selecting a commerce platform, choosing a frontend framework, integrating APIs, connecting third-party services, and thoroughly testing the user experience before launch.

7. Is headless commerce worth the investment for a mid-market retailer?

For growing retailers, headless commerce can deliver long-term value through improved flexibility, faster innovation, and easier scalability. The return on investment depends on implementation costs, business goals, and the complexity of your digital commerce ecosystem.

8. What business problems does headless commerce solve?

Headless commerce helps address limited frontend flexibility, slow feature releases, difficult third-party integrations, and inconsistent customer experiences across multiple channels. It is particularly valuable for organizations pursuing enterprise headless commerce initiatives or expanding into headless commerce for B2B.

9. How much should I budget for a headless commerce implementation?

Costs vary depending on platform selection, integrations, custom development, infrastructure, and ongoing support. A phased implementation approach can help manage costs while reducing project risk.

10. What hidden costs should I expect?

Beyond implementation, businesses should budget for API usage, cloud hosting, middleware, third-party integrations, security, monitoring, and ongoing maintenance. Understanding these recurring expenses is essential when planning an enterprise headless commerce strategy.

11. How do I reduce migration risks during re-platforming?

Successful migrations begin with careful planning. Businesses should assess existing systems, migrate in phases, thoroughly test integrations, and monitor performance throughout the transition to minimize operational disruption.

12. Why do some headless commerce projects fail?

Projects often exceed budgets due to unclear requirements, poor integration planning, unrealistic timelines, or inadequate technical expertise. Defining clear objectives and following a phased implementation strategy significantly improve project success.

13. How does headless commerce impact SEO and site performance?

A well-designed headless architecture can improve page speed, Core Web Vitals, and overall user experience. Protecting SEO during migration requires proper URL management, redirects, metadata preservation, and technical optimization.
